We can simplify this by knowing that dut is a wrapper around pexpect. For example, by expecting the appearance of the Bootloader instead of catching each character.
Example of simplified code that should work:
with open(f"{boot_dir}/{image}", "rb") as fd:
try:
self.dut.expect_exact("Bootloader", timeout=60)
time.sleep(1)
self.dut.serial.write(fd.read())
self.dut.expect_exact("(psh)%", timeout=80)
except pexpect.TIMEOUT as e:
raise FlashError(
msg="Timeout waiting for boatloader prompt or psh prompt.",
output=e.stdout.decode("ascii") if e.stdout else None,
) from e
Remember also that when you use a context manager in Python, it automatically handles the closing of resources opened within it, so you don't need to manually close them with fd.close()
